Eli Zaretskii <address@hidden> writes:
> As I wrote earlier today in another thread, the branches on the trunk
> were reorganized, I don't know by whom and why. Perhaps this is the
> reason for the humongous data size bzr needed to fetch. But that's
> just a guess.
The branches are all sharing the same repository, so it does not matter
where they are located or how they are named.
